HE Parts is in the mining industry, but we don't mine. We do aftermarket repairs for mining equipment such as Caterpillar, Komatsu, Hitachi, construction machinery. Think of us as the Jiffy Lube that we service all cars. So we do that with all of our mining equipment. And we re-engineer parts, so we make them better than the OEM. We have important engineering drawings and IP that is critical to keep within our departments. Our legacy environment was very fragmented. So we had lots of different solutions out there, but it wasn't cohesive in our environment. So we run a very lean team, and we only have a few resources that are in each region. So having the depth of knowledge you really need is difficult if you're trying to get the best of the best and mash them together. I would also say you get blind spots if you're fragmented. So you think you might have the best of the best and everything's working great, but it's actually very fragmented, and you have these blind spots that you don't know are an issue until that issue arises. Like most other companies, we have had some people become a victim of some phishing attacks. We engaged Fortinet and their incident response team to really help us. We had bought the tools, but we had not fully implemented them, but Fortinet team was able to come and work alongside us, helping us do a full forensics, ensuring that we were safe and compliant. It has really helped us accelerate implementing some of the other tools. So one of the first things that we are really focusing on is rolling out data loss protection within our environment, and we actually have visibility of where things are going. Whether that's rogue AI tools that we're able to see data being uploaded, even within our approved AI tools, we're able to call some of that data out where it is being put out in unsafe areas that aren't approved. So we're able to start pushing some of those rules out and fine-tuning in a safe and appropriate way to approach AI. With being a global company, we have a lot of remote workers. So some of the products, the SASE, the DLP, endpoint protection is really critical as we have people traveling, are we keeping the company protected? We've really been on a journey of first getting this discovery, being able to see the data and where it's moving, so that we can work with our head of compliance and our parent company to continuously tighten up our data policies. And so right now where we've started down this journey, we're slowly tightening the guardrails. Just being able to have the visibility and the clarity has really moved our team to the next level.
